Low-Fidelity Conversational Interface

Organization: Boulder Valley Women’s Health Center is a nonprofit reproductive and sexual health clinic.

Project: Develop a dual-language (English-Spanish) anonymous comprehensive sexual health information text messaging line for teens.

Year: 2007

Role: Youth Services Director + Project Lead

Major Responsibilities: Secure + manage grant funding, Assemble + manage project team, Develop + execute research methodologies, Assess + adopt technologies, Co-design + launch text message line, Analyze + report user data

Process: Research. Design + Deploy. Capacity Building.

Research: Design, facilitate + process user focus groups; Design, deploy + analyze user surveys; Document user feedback

Design + Deploy: Identify technologies in play, assess + adopt; Develop + implement content strategy; Design + deploy brand; Document + respond to ongoing user feedback

Capacity Building: Develop + deploy awareness building communications for internal (board, staff) stakeholders; Develop + deploy ability building tools for project team (playbooks); Assess diverse levels of access for external (users) stakeholders; Develop + deploy awareness + action communications for external (users) stakeholders

Outcomes: 

  • Anonymous text line continues to operate in 2023
  • Thousands of sexual health questions answered accurately
  • Text line replicated by Planned Parenthood of the Rocky Mountains
  • Technology presented at several statewide (Colorado) conferences (2009) and at the National Sex Tech Conference (2008)
